The pinetime using infinitime basically does that, albeit without always on and the heart rate monitor only fires off when the screen wakes up or when you go into the applet and click start. But i usually get around 2 weeks of battery life with it, maybe more.

Its probably not as good as this, but on the plus side, it's like a $25-35 watch before shipping.
